The Bang & Olufsen Beosystem 3000c Dune Grey Edition is Chic

The Bang & Olufsen Beosystem 3000c Dune Grey Edition is a new audio offering from the Danish brand that draws inspiration from the 80s to deliver audiophiles with a system that feels inherently modern.

The system is observed in the namesake Dune Grey finish that prioritizes a neutral, natural hue with technological overtones to work well in a variety of spaces. This is paired with dark walnut wood that works with the metallic tone to achieve a Nordic coastline-inspired aesthetic. The system might put the 80s era turntable in the spotlight, but the Beolab 8 speakers are engineered with modern capabilities in mind to offer WiFi and Bluetooth 5.3 connectivity to work with modern streaming services.

The Bang & Olufsen Beosystem 3000c Dune Grey Edition is limited to 100 units priced at $30,000 each.
